Ecology

Definition of Ecology as it relates to Science, Environmental Science, Toxicology

Ecology in the context of Toxicology examines the effects of toxic substances on ecosystems and organisms, as well as their interactions with the environment. It incorporates principles from Science, Environmental Science, and Toxicology to understand how pollutants impact ecological systems, biodiversity, population dynamics, and community structure. Ecotoxicology, a key area of study within this subcategory, explores the impacts of toxic chemicals on entire ecosystems, including their biotic and abiotic components. Research in this field helps inform environmental policies, risk assessments, and conservation strategies aimed at minimizing harmful effects and promoting sustainable practices.
